We must first remember the characteristics of the three:
String string Constants
StringBuffer string variable (thread safe)
StringBuilder string variable (not thread safe)

Dynamic string StringBuilderThe System.Text.StringBuilder class can implement dynamic strings compared to the string class. In addition, the dynamic meaning is that when the string is modified, the system does not need to create a new object, does not repeatedly open up new memory space, but directly on the original StringBuilder object based on the modification. The String object is immutable. Each time you use one of the methods in the System.String class, you create a new string object in memory, which requires a new space to be allocated for the new object. The overhead associated with creating a new string object can be very expensive in situations where you need to perform repeated modifications to the string. System overhead related to creating a new String object may be very expensive. If you want to modify the string without creating a new object, you can use the System. Text. StringBuilder class. For example, when many strings are connected together in a loop, using the StringBuilder class can improve performance.
